Toledo man indicted 
in murder at gas station

5/31/2013
BLADE STAFF

 

A Toledo man accused in La’Quan Dunbar’s April 29 shooting death was indicted Thursday on two counts of murder with firearms specifications.

Quincy Allen, 21, of 1343 Oak Hill Ct. is charged in the death of Mr. Dunbar, 20, who was shot once in the head outside a central Toledo gas station.

Allen, who was held Thursday in the Lucas County jail in lieu of $1 million bond, also was indicted last week on a charge of aggravated robbery stemming from a May 15 hold-up.

According to court records, a Toledo man said he gave Allen and Frederick Watson, 20, of 1145 Belmont St. a ride.

Allen then allegedly put a gun to the victim’s head and demanded money while Mr. Watson tried to search his pockets. Mr. Watson also was indicted for aggravated robbery.
